Output 66f02fa08bb22f840fb2a003ae75bf286d8f17f2cce306d0186195b861d59eed:1

value
16589728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ce4150b3b5032059ba561e64ad1374a56338382e OP_EQUALVERIFY OP_CHECKSIG
address
1KoaShacjvpKZrCobxKWxzf8JWsEykoLya
transaction
66f02fa08bb22f840fb2a003ae75bf286d8f17f2cce306d0186195b861d59eed
spent
true